From January 2026 to May 2026, our team evaluated 50+ agencies to identify the top enterprise SEO agencies of 2026. We scored each using the following weighted criteria:
- Leadership Experience Score (30%): Executive team credentials, including prior experience in enterprise marketing and their track record of maintaining long-term client relationships.
- Notable Clients (25%): Quality and prominence of enterprise-level clients in the agency’s portfolio, indicating their ability to handle complex, high-stakes SEO campaigns.
- Average Reviews (25%): A 1.0–5.0 score aggregated from third-party review platforms, with higher weight given to reviews from enterprise clients.
- Years in Business (12%): Long-running, established agencies indicate adaptability across changing SEO landscapes and economic conditions.
- Company Size (8%): Larger teams generally signal greater capacity to manage the scale and stakeholder complexity of enterprise SEO campaigns.

AMP Agency
For enterprises where visual storytelling drives buyer decisions, AMP Agency delivers an impressive combination of video production capabilities and SEO expertise. Their work with major brands like Amazon, Southwest Airlines, and LinkedIn demonstrates their ability to create interactive digital experiences that capture attention in crowded enterprise markets.
With over three decades of experience, AMP has refined their processes to consistently deliver campaigns on time and on budget. Their teams bring fresh creative perspectives to technical subjects, making them particularly valuable for enterprises seeking to humanize their brand or launch consumer-facing initiatives.
Potential clients should consider that their video-centric model requires substantial content production budgets and longer lead times for campaign development, which may not align with enterprises needing rapid deployment or primarily text-based content strategies.

Major Tom/Sheng Li Digital
Expanding into Chinese markets presents unique challenges that many generalist agencies simply cannot navigate effectively. Major Tom’s specialized expertise in reaching Chinese audiences has made them the go-to partner for internationally recognized brands like Cirque du Soleil and KLM Royal Dutch Airlines. Beyond basic translation, they create localized content that resonates with Chinese cultural values and buying behaviors while maintaining brand identity. Their influencer marketing and media buying capabilities tap into distribution channels that Western agencies often don’t understand or have access to.
Their boutique size and specialized focus do present a potential drawback for some enterprise clients, so firms seeking a primary agency for global SEO across multiple markets will likely need to supplement with additional partners.
